45453

Базы данных РВ. Структура. Применение. Особенности. Особенности Industrial SQL Server. Функциональные возможности сервера базы данных. Интеграция с другими компонентами комплекса. Возможность организации клиент-серверной системы

Доклад

Информатика, кибернетика и программирование

Эта БД позволяет обеспечить доступ к БД при помощи языка SQL и обеспечить хранение информации в заданном пользователем виде. Для системы РВ не являющейся СЖРВ реляционная БД является оптимальной но для СЖРВ требуется обеспечение следующих условий: высокоскоростной сбор информации 1015 параметров за 1 секунду возможность хранения больших объемов информации обеспечение доступа к информации с различных рабочих станций по сетевому протоколу Для решения проблемы были разработаны БД БД реального времени: Industril SQLserver WizSQL...

Русский

2013-11-17

454 KB

12 чел.

Базы данных РВ. Структура. Применение. Особенности. Особенности Industrial SQL Server. Функциональные возможности сервера базы данных. Интеграция с другими компонентами комплекса. Возможность организации клиент-серверной системы.

БД реального времени

Любая система РВ должна сохранять информацию в структурированном виде. Этот вид обеспечивает средство, называемое реляционной БД. Эта БД позволяет обеспечить доступ к БД при помощи языка SQL и обеспечить хранение информации в заданном пользователем виде. Для системы РВ, не являющейся СЖРВ, реляционная БД является оптимальной, но для СЖРВ требуется обеспечение следующих условий:

  1.  высокоскоростной сбор информации (10-15 параметров за 1 секунду)
  2.  возможность хранения больших объемов информации
  3.  обеспечение доступа к информации с различных рабочих станций по сетевому протоколу

Для решения проблемы были разработаны БД – БД реального времени: Industrial SQL-server, WizSQL, TraceMode.

Особенности Industrial SQL-server

1. Базовым ядром СУБД является Microsoft SQL-server

2. Industrial SQL-server входит в состав программных комплексов и обеспечивает доступ к драйверам без дополнительных программных модулей

3. Общезаводской хранитель информации включает данные о событиях и соответствующих реакциях

4. В Industrial SQL-server реализованы внутренние механизмы сбора информации на небольшом дисковом пространстве

Поэтому Industrial SQL-server работает в 100 раз быстрее, чем реляционная БД на аналогичной платформе.

Схема реализации Industrial SQL-server

Любой источник / приемник информации передает данные непосредственно в СУБД. СУБД обеспечивает хранение данных, выдачу информации и необходимые операции по преобразованию. Потребитель информации работает с СУБД таким же образом как и для стандартных БД.

Принцип функционирования Industrial SQL-server

Вся технологическая информация, получаемая с датчиков, сохраняется в специальных таблицах расширения. Таблицы расширения используют для хранения информации специализированных типов данных.

Специальные типы данных – представление информации в соответствии с физическим смыслом параметра. Запросы пользователя обеспечиваются через стандартный интерфейс в нереальном времени за счет таблиц расширения поддерживается сохранение больших потоков информации, разделение пользовательских данных и данных с датчиков. Поддержка целостности данных обеспечивается СУБД. Управление пользовательскими таблицами осуществляется через стандартный интерфейс. Семантическая целостность контролируется пользователем. Создание технологических таблиц осуществляется через SCADA-приложения, и целостность гарантируется самой структурой. Архитектура: клиент-сервер.


Функциональные возможности сервера БД.

1. Высокая производительность достигается через масштабирование системы, а также через многоуровневую клиент-серверную архитектуру.

Источник – SCADA

Приемник – АСУТП

Количество подключений пользователя не зависит от производительности сервера.

2. Уменьшение объема хранения информации. Выполняется за счет механизма упаковки данных и их сжатия. Вся архивная информация сохраняется в упакованном виде. Распакованной является только оперативная информация.

3. Отсутствие алгоритмов защиты данных.

4. Защита данных осуществляется за счет средств SCADA и АСУТП верхним уровнем программного обеспечения.

5. Достоверная информация обеспечивается SCADA, т.к. позволяет сохранить одновременно порядка 80 значений. Для проверки достоверности полученная информация сравнивается со следующими данными: конфигурация, информация от операторов, сведения о событиях, информация об авариях, информация системы контроля, технологическая информация. Объединение этой информации представляет пользователю структуру всего технологического процесса.

6. Сервер РВ реализуется через протокол обмена со SCADA-приложением. Протокол характеризуется наличием меток, по которым осуществляется передача информации.

7. Система регистрации событий. Сохранение информации, поступающий непрерывно осуществляется по механизму событий. Событие служит переключателем между массивами данных.

8. Гибкий открытый доступ. Доступ к открытой информации со стороны пользователя осуществляется через стандартный интерфейс, в котором определены группы и права пользователей и обеспечивается защита системой паролей доступа к технологической информации, являющейся специфической.

9. Наличие языка SQL с поддержкой временных параметров. Поддержка осуществляется добавлением в SQL запрос временных параметров по принципу задачи.

10. Открытая и гибкая БД Industrial SQL-server поддерживает доступ к информации реального времени, а также архивной.

Данные Industrial SQL-server используются в:

- анализ протекания процесса, диагностика оптимизации;

- управление запасами;

- техническое обслуживание систем;

- контроль количества выпускаемой продукции;

Функционирование в качестве системы управления технологическим процессом.

11. Простота использования.

12. Интеграция с другими компонентами комплексов. Обеспечивается за счет стандартных средств ОС.

13. Организация доступа с нескольких узлов. Обеспечивается клиент-серверной архитектурой.

14. Возможность расширения. Конечные пользователи могут разрабатывать собственные специализированные программы необходимые для анализа и представления данных, используемых свойство интерфейса ODBC.


Простота использования.

Заключается в том, что Industrial SQL Server не требует от пользователя знания SQL-языка. Он ориентирован на готовые наборы функций. Управление резервированием и управление базой данных осуществляется средствами Microsoft SQL.

Интеграция с другими компонентами комплекса.

Выполняется с помощью стандартных средств операционной системы: RTFX, DDE, SuitLink. Интеграция производится со следующими компонентами:

  •  SCADA-приложения InTouch;
  •  система контроля ввода данных;
  •  система доступа к архивной информации.

Возможность организации клиент-серверной системы.

Вычислительный узел, на котором установлено Industrial SQL Server, может являться сервером для других приложений (приложений сторонних производителей). Сервер может быть организован как для технологического процесса, так и для уровня пользовательских приложений. Доступ может обеспечиваться через Internet.

Существует возможность отправки сообщений по электронной почте, а также возможность коммуникаций с другими СУБД.

Возможность расширения.

Конечные пользователи для данной СУБД могут разрабатывать собственные специализированные программы, необходимые для анализа и представления данных. Для этого используется интерфейс ODBC.

Данные функциональные возможности позволяет использовать Industrial SQL Server в режиме РВ.

Комплексные программные средства разработки приложений реального времени.

Комплексный программный продукт – система, позволяющая автоматизировать уровень производства и технологического процесса. Группа этих систем называется автоматизация производства, поэтому комплексный программный продукт должен предоставлять информацию для руководителя предприятия, для отделов разработки и эксплуатации. Продукт информатизации. Информатизация – поддержка процесса управления информации. На текущий момент существует 3 различные системы, обеспечивающие интеграцию АСУП и АСУТП.

  1.  WizFactory
  2.  Factory Suile
  3.  T-Factory


Данные системы объединяют уровень производственной информации, т.е. ресурсы и т.д. и уровень технологического процесса. Данные комплексы позволяют обеспечить неразрывную связь уровнем управления промышленным процессом и уровнем бизнеса (менеджментом предприятия).

Основное назначение продукта – анализ производства в целом и моделирование отдельных этапов. Моделирование необходимо для формирования прогноза по реализации основных средств предприятия на базе существующей и накопленной информации. Эти продукты позволяют создать стратегию развития предприятия.

В состав программного продукта должны входить:

1. SCADA-приложения (обеспечивает управление технологическим процессом, протекающем на предприятии);

2. реляционная БД

3. система управления оборудованием и процессом (средство для формирования процесса на основе решения руководства.) Система позволяет строить диаграммы линейной логики и диаграммы функционирования системы.

4. Средства просмотра данных: локально и дистанционно. Возможность построения распределенных приложений с целью получения информации и нескольких узлов одновременно.

5. Система управления производством (хозяйственная, финансовая и др. службы – эта система должна представлять прикладные программы управления производством, моделируя и отслеживая каждую стадию производственного процесса).

6. Система отчетов по установленным формам.

Основное применение: большие сложные производства, такие как нефтедобыча, газодобыча, производство потребительской продукции, система управления движения транспорта. 


 

А также другие работы, которые могут Вас заинтересовать

43057. Разработка предложений по созданию логистической системы 319.93 KB
  Выбор и обоснование типа автотранспортного средства.1 Поставщики № поставщика Поставщик 51 Полтава 54 Карловка полтавса 61 Донецк 67 Красноармейск донец 83 ВолодарскВолынский житомир 85 Черняхов житомир 87 Городница житомио 114 Городище луганс 200 Монастыриска тернопол 350 Курджиново краснодар Порты отправления: Ейск Херсон Керчь. т Стоимость транспортировки 1т за 1км: С1км = 05 ден. Общая характеристика проектной ситуации Транспортная характеристика груза Стекло в ящиках витринное: Твердый прозрачный хрупкий материал получаемый...
43058. Разработка информационной системы по учёту продукции сети аптек 1001.5 KB
  Результаты дипломной работы – программное средство, с помощью которого можно вести учет продукции, оно является Windows – приложением и имеет удобный интерфейс. Программное средство даёт возможность просматривать данные, добавлять новые данные, изменять и удалять существующие данные, а также осуществлять поиск по таблицам.
43059. Проект электродинамического громкоговорителя 601 KB
  Для этого по графику зависимости (xm) (рис.2) находим минимальное допустимое, при заданной амплитуде смещения xm, значение ширины свободного воздушного зазора bз, от размера которого зависит скорость теплообмена и допустимая удельная мощность, которая рассеивается единицей поверхности. Величину Руд находим по графику зависимости Руд() (рис.3).
43060. МЕНЕДЖМЕНТ ПРОФЕСІЙНОЇ ДІЯЛЬНОСТІ 197.5 KB
  5 Методичні вказівки з виконання курсової роботи в межах курсу Менеджмент професійної діяльності для студентів спеціальностей напрямку підготовки 8. В процесі виконання курсової роботи керівником проектування здійснюються індивідуальні і групові консультації. Методичні вказівки З виконаннЯ курсової роботи 4.
43061. Основи менеджменту. Методичні вказівки 263 KB
  У роботі передбачається що студент уважно розгляне зовнішні і внутрішні чинники що впливають на діяльність організації і з урахуванням особливостей моменту буде використовувати розглянуті теоретичні положення. Загальний аналіз діяльності конкретної організації. Опис організації і її продукту. Бачення майбутнього організації.
43062. Модернизация привода главного движения универсального токарно-винторезного станка модели 1М63 2.8 MB
  Станок универсальный токарно-винторезный модели 1М63 предназначен для выполнения самых разнообразных токарных работ, в том числе точения конусов и нарезания резьб метрической, дюймовой, модульной и питчевой.
43063. Расчет аппарата гашения извести в производстве известкового молока на ОАО «АВИСМА» 319 KB
  Гашение извести протекает по реакции: CO H2O = COH2 1593 ккал. Вместе с тем следует избегать и переохлаждения гасящейся извести так как оно может значительно замедлить процесс гашения извести. С ростом температуры выделившийся гидрат окиси кальция выпадает в осадок и обволакивает поверхность кусков негашеной извести.
43064. Детали машин, расчет основных показателей 1.52 MB
  Выбор электродвигателя и кинематический расчет привода. Расчет клиноременной передачи. Расчет двухступенчатого цилиндрического редуктора. Предварительный расчет валов. Конструктивные размеры корпуса редуктора Определение реакций в подшипниках...